[data-v-8c8ac609]:root{--primary-color:var(--p-primary-color);--primary-contrast-color:var(--p-primary-contrast-color);--text-color:var(--p-text-color);--text-color-secondary:var(--p-text-muted-color);--surface-border:var(--p-content-border-color);--surface-card:var(--p-content-background);--surface-hover:var(--p-content-hover-background);--surface-overlay:var(--p-overlay-popover-background);--transition-duration:var(--p-transition-duration);--maskbg:var(--p-mask-background);--content-border-radius:var(--p-content-border-radius);--layout-section-transition-duration:.2s;--element-transition-duration:var(--p-transition-duration);--focus-ring-width:var(--p-focus-ring-width);--focus-ring-style:var(--p-focus-ring-style);--focus-ring-color:var(--p-focus-ring-color);--focus-ring-offset:var(--p-focus-ring-offset);--focus-ring-shadow:var(--p-focus-ring-shadow)}.error-page[data-v-8c8ac609]{align-items:center;background:linear-gradient(135deg,var(--surface-ground) 0,var(--surface-section) 100%);display:flex;justify-content:center;min-height:100vh;padding:2rem}.error-container[data-v-8c8ac609]{background:var(--surface-card);border:1px solid var(--surface-border);border-radius:12px;box-shadow:0 4px 20px #0000001a;max-width:600px;padding:3rem 2rem;text-align:center;width:100%}.error-illustration[data-v-8c8ac609]{animation:bounce-8c8ac609 2s infinite;margin-bottom:2rem}.error-title[data-v-8c8ac609]{color:var(--primary-color);font-size:6rem;font-weight:700;line-height:1;margin:0}.error-subtitle[data-v-8c8ac609]{color:var(--text-color);font-size:1.75rem;font-weight:600;margin:1rem 0 .5rem}.error-description[data-v-8c8ac609]{color:var(--text-color-secondary);font-size:1.1rem;line-height:1.6;margin-bottom:2rem}.error-actions[data-v-8c8ac609]{display:flex;flex-wrap:wrap;gap:1rem;justify-content:center;margin-bottom:2rem}.error-tech-info[data-v-8c8ac609]{border-top:1px solid var(--surface-border);margin-top:2rem;padding-top:2rem}.tech-title[data-v-8c8ac609]{color:var(--text-color-secondary);font-size:.9rem;margin-bottom:.5rem}.tech-message[data-v-8c8ac609]{background:var(--surface-ground);border-radius:6px;color:var(--text-color);display:block;font-size:.85rem;padding:.75rem;word-break:break-word}@keyframes bounce-8c8ac609{0%,20%,50%,80%,to{transform:translateY(0)}40%{transform:translateY(-10px)}60%{transform:translateY(-5px)}}@media (max-width:959.6px){.error-container[data-v-8c8ac609]{padding:2rem 1rem}.error-title[data-v-8c8ac609]{font-size:4rem}.error-subtitle[data-v-8c8ac609]{font-size:1.5rem}.error-actions[data-v-8c8ac609]{align-items:center;flex-direction:column}.error-actions .p-button[data-v-8c8ac609]{max-width:250px;width:100%}}
